2009-02-18 35 views
12

Đơn giản tôi nghĩ nhưng về cơ bản tôi cần biết cú pháp của hàm lưu trên PIL là gì. Sự giúp đỡ thực sự mơ hồ và tôi không thể tìm thấy bất cứ điều gì trực tuyến. Bất kỳ sự giúp đỡ nào là tuyệt vời, cảm ơn :).Thư viện hình ảnh Python Lưu cú pháp hàm

+1

Bằng "trợ giúp", bạn có đang đề cập đến chuỗi tài liệu không nói gì ngoài "Lưu hình ảnh vào tệp hoặc luồng" không? :( – endolith

Trả lời

18

Từ PIL Handbook:

im.save(outfile, options...) 

im.save(outfile, format, options...) 

trường hợp đơn giản nhất:

im.save('my_image.png') 

hoặc bất cứ điều gì. Trong trường hợp này, loại hình ảnh sẽ được xác định từ phần mở rộng. Có vấn đề cụ thể nào bạn đang gặp phải không? Hoặc tùy chọn lưu cụ thể mà bạn muốn sử dụng nhưng không chắc chắn cách thực hiện?

Bạn có thể tìm thấy thông tin bổ sung trong tài liệu về từng loại tệp. The PIL Handbox Appendixes liệt kê các loại tệp khác nhau được hỗ trợ. Trong một số trường hợp, các tùy chọn được cung cấp cho save. Ví dụ, trên JPEG file format page, chúng ta biết rằng tiết kiệm hỗ trợ

  • quality
  • optimize, và
  • progressive

với các ghi chú về mỗi tuỳ chọn.

+1

Câu trả lời hay cho câu hỏi không phù hợp (tài nguyên chắc chắn có sẵn trực tuyến). :) – zgoda

+0

ik có thể chọn tùy chọn nào cho định dạng .. ?? – shiva

1

Image.save(filename[, format[, options]]). Bạn thường có thể chỉ sử dụng Image.save(filename) vì nó tự động tìm ra loại tệp cho bạn từ tiện ích.

Các vấn đề liên quan